Proprietors and winemakers from Diamond Terrace, Snowden, Chappellet, Sawyer, Tres Sabores, Joseph Phelps and Corison will be pouring their wines on Tuesdays in March and April at a/k/a a bistro at 1320 Main Street in St. Helena, CA.
From 6:30 p.m. until 8:00 p.m., the winemaker / winery owner circulates among diners and offers 3 or 4 wines as a tasting flight for $9.00. The diner can choose from the menu as he or she wishes: there is no obligation to have a specific dinner. On Tuesdays the a/k/a a bistro's special is a 3-course prix fixe dinner which begins with freshly house-made mozzarella, wild boar ragu-sauced penne and huckleberry sorbet.

a/k/a a bistro is attracting a following not only for its day-by-day specials but also for its use of specialty and artisanal food purveyors, including short ribs and all beef products from Painted Hills (Oregon) and a double-cut Prairie Fresh pork chop. a/k/a a bistro uses only all-natural and sustainably farmed meats and produce, with no antibiotics or hormones. Corkage is waived Sunday through Thursday and is $8 Friday and Saturday.
Customers can depend on a/k/a a bistro for weekly specials, including handmade pasta on Wednesday, all-natural beef short ribs on Thursday, bouillabaisse on Friday and coq au vin on Saturday. The menu offers a wide range of small and large plates across a modern reading of California bistro cuisine. The complete menu can be found at www.akabistro.com. Other favorites are a/k/a a bistro’s signature Portobello fries with truffle aioli and a Reuben sandwich
The restaurant is open for lunch beginning at 11:30 a.m. seven days a week; dinner Tuesday through Thursday 4:30 – 9:00 p.m., Friday & Saturday 4:30 – 9:30 p.m. and on Sunday 4:30 – 8:30 p.m.
Locals know this space as the former Keller’s Market (the original Keller’s sign still hangs out front) and the interior incorporates the pressed tin ceiling familiar to long-time customers of the beloved butcher shop as well as twig-wrapped light pendants, a comfy front lounge and eco-friendly fireplace.
Robert and Deborah Simon also own and operate Bistro 45 in Pasadena, California, which they founded 20 years ago.
